Output 54dbb68a633ff4d15405653f80966b68a4f6d0f8face6d7f663935d4ddf4e0af:1

value
102362028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ef422c2a0495858e3b88f964ba2d6d1655e15fa OP_EQUAL
address
MDe2bB7e64kWDEruuPhF5vNcBp3Pm5ZzB2
transaction
54dbb68a633ff4d15405653f80966b68a4f6d0f8face6d7f663935d4ddf4e0af
spent
true